Strategic Material Selection Guide for smartphone manufacturer

When selecting materials for smartphone manufacturing, understanding the properties, advantages, disadvantages, and compliance requirements of each material is crucial for international B2B buyers. This guide analyzes four common materials used in smartphone production: aluminum, glass, plastic, and ceramic. Each material has its unique characteristics that can significantly affect the performance, durability, and cost of the final product.

What Are the Key Properties of Aluminum in Smartphone Manufacturing?

Aluminum is widely used in smartphone casings due to its excellent strength-to-weight ratio and corrosion resistance. It can withstand high temperatures and pressures, making it suitable for various environmental conditions. The material is also recyclable, which aligns with sustainability goals.

Pros & Cons:
Pros: Lightweight, durable, and aesthetically pleasing. Aluminum can be anodized for enhanced corrosion resistance and can be machined into complex shapes.
Cons: Higher manufacturing complexity and costs compared to some alternatives. It is also less impact-resistant than materials like plastic.

Impact on Application: Aluminum is often used for the outer casing of smartphones, providing structural integrity and a premium feel. However, it may not be suitable for devices requiring extensive wireless communication due to its interference with signals.

Considerations for International Buyers: Compliance with standards such as ASTM and JIS is essential. Buyers should also consider the local recycling regulations in their regions, such as those in Europe, which have stringent e-waste management laws.

How Does Glass Contribute to Smartphone Performance?

Glass is primarily used for smartphone screens due to its transparency and scratch resistance. Materials like Gorilla Glass are designed to withstand significant impacts and scratches, enhancing the longevity of the device.

Pros & Cons:
Pros: Excellent clarity and touch sensitivity. Glass can be treated to improve its strength and resistance to scratches.
Cons: Fragility compared to metals and plastics, making it susceptible to shattering upon impact.

Impact on Application: Glass is critical for the user interface and visual appeal of smartphones. The choice of glass can affect touch sensitivity and display quality.

Considerations for International Buyers: Buyers should ensure that the glass meets international safety standards. In regions like Africa and South America, where repair services may be limited, opting for more robust glass types can be beneficial.

What Role Does Plastic Play in Smartphone Manufacturing?

Plastic is commonly used in smartphone housing and internal components due to its lightweight nature and cost-effectiveness. Various types of plastics, such as polycarbonate, offer good impact resistance.

Pros & Cons:
Pros: Low cost and ease of manufacturing. Plastic can be molded into complex shapes, allowing for innovative designs.
Cons: Generally less durable than metals and glass, and may not provide the same premium feel.

Impact on Application: Plastic is often used for budget-friendly smartphones, where cost reduction is a priority. However, it may not appeal to consumers looking for premium products.

Considerations for International Buyers: Compliance with environmental regulations regarding plastic use is crucial, especially in Europe, where there are strict guidelines on plastic waste. Buyers should also consider the recyclability of the plastics used.

Why Is Ceramic Becoming Popular in Smartphone Manufacturing?

Ceramic materials are gaining traction in smartphone manufacturing due to their unique properties, including high scratch resistance and aesthetic appeal. Ceramics can offer a premium look and feel while providing durability.

Pros & Cons:
Pros: Excellent scratch resistance and a premium finish. Ceramics are also highly durable and can withstand high temperatures.
Cons: Higher manufacturing costs and complexity. Ceramics can be brittle, leading to potential breakage under impact.

Impact on Application: Ceramic is often used in high-end smartphones, particularly for back covers. Its unique aesthetic can differentiate products in a crowded market.

Considerations for International Buyers: Buyers should be aware of the higher costs associated with ceramic materials and ensure compliance with relevant standards. In regions like the Middle East, where luxury products are in demand, ceramic can be a strong selling point.

In-depth Look: Manufacturing Processes and Quality Assurance for smartphone manufacturer

What Are the Main Stages of the Manufacturing Process for Smartphone Manufacturers?

The manufacturing process of smartphones is complex, involving several key stages that ensure the production of high-quality devices. For international B2B buyers, understanding these stages can facilitate better decision-making when selecting suppliers.

  1. Material Preparation:
    – This stage involves sourcing and preparing raw materials such as metals (aluminum, copper), plastics, and glass. Suppliers often focus on the quality and sustainability of these materials to meet international standards. Buyers should inquire about the suppliers’ sourcing practices and whether they engage in responsible material procurement.

  2. Forming:
    – In the forming stage, raw materials are shaped into components. Techniques such as injection molding for plastics and stamping for metals are commonly used. Advanced manufacturing technologies, such as CNC machining, are also employed to achieve precision in component production. B2B buyers should assess the capabilities of their suppliers regarding forming technologies to ensure they can produce high-quality components.

  3. Assembly:
    – The assembly stage is where components are brought together to create the final product. This often involves automated assembly lines that enhance efficiency and reduce human error. Buyers should evaluate the supplier’s assembly processes, including the use of robotics and automation, to ensure consistent quality in the final smartphone products.

  4. Finishing:
    – This final stage includes surface treatments, painting, and quality checks before the product is packaged for shipment. Techniques like anodizing and coating are used to enhance the aesthetic and functional properties of the smartphone. Buyers should confirm that suppliers adhere to finishing standards that align with their branding requirements.

How Is Quality Assurance Implemented in Smartphone Manufacturing?

Quality assurance (QA) is critical in ensuring that smartphones meet both customer expectations and regulatory standards. Here are some key aspects of the QA process relevant to B2B buyers:

  1. What International Standards Should Buyers Be Aware Of?
    ISO 9001: This standard focuses on quality management systems and is crucial for suppliers aiming to demonstrate their commitment to quality. Buyers should ask suppliers for certification to ISO 9001 as part of their quality assurance strategy.
    CE Marking: Particularly relevant for buyers in Europe, CE marking indicates compliance with health, safety, and environmental protection standards. Understanding whether a supplier’s products are CE marked can help mitigate regulatory risks.

  2. What Are the Key Quality Control Checkpoints?
    Incoming Quality Control (IQC): This initial checkpoint involves inspecting raw materials and components before they enter the production process. Buyers should ensure that suppliers have robust IQC procedures in place to prevent defects from the outset.
    In-Process Quality Control (IPQC): During the manufacturing process, regular checks are performed to monitor the production quality. Buyers can request documentation of IPQC processes to verify consistency in production quality.
    Final Quality Control (FQC): Before shipment, the final products undergo extensive testing to ensure they meet specifications. B2B buyers should understand the types of tests performed and the acceptance criteria used by their suppliers.

What Common Testing Methods Are Used in Smartphone Manufacturing?

Testing methods are essential for ensuring the reliability and functionality of smartphones. Here are some common techniques:

  1. Functional Testing: This checks if all features and functions of the smartphone operate correctly. It typically includes testing the touchscreen, camera, buttons, and connectivity features.

  2. Performance Testing: This evaluates the device’s performance under various conditions, such as battery life, processing speed, and thermal management. It is crucial for ensuring that the smartphone meets market expectations.

  3. Durability Testing: This involves subjecting the smartphone to extreme conditions, such as drops, water exposure, and temperature variations, to assess its resilience. Buyers should inquire if their suppliers conduct standardized durability tests.

Comprehensive Cost and Pricing Analysis for smartphone manufacturer Sourcing

What Are the Key Cost Components in Smartphone Manufacturing?

When sourcing smartphones, understanding the cost structure is critical for B2B buyers. The primary cost components include:

  1. Materials: The quality and type of materials, such as semiconductors, glass, and metals, significantly impact the overall cost. Premium materials may enhance performance but can also increase the price.

  2. Labor: Labor costs vary by region and can be influenced by local wages, skill levels, and labor laws. Manufacturers in regions with lower labor costs may offer competitive pricing but may compromise on quality.

  3. Manufacturing Overhead: This encompasses all indirect costs associated with production, such as utilities, facility maintenance, and administrative expenses. Efficient manufacturing processes can help reduce overhead costs.

  4. Tooling: Tooling refers to the equipment and machinery used in production. The initial investment in tooling can be substantial, but it amortizes over high production volumes.

  5. Quality Control (QC): Ensuring product quality involves testing and inspections that incur additional costs. Implementing robust QC processes can prevent costly recalls and reputational damage.

  6. Logistics: Shipping and handling costs are essential to consider, especially for international buyers. Factors such as distance, shipping method, and customs duties can significantly affect total costs.

  7. Margin: Manufacturers typically add a profit margin on top of their costs, which can vary widely. Understanding the margin can help buyers assess the overall pricing strategy.

How Do Price Influencers Affect Smartphone Sourcing Decisions?

Several factors influence smartphone pricing, which can vary depending on the buyer’s specific needs and market conditions:

  • Volume/MOQ (Minimum Order Quantity): Higher order volumes usually lead to lower unit prices due to economies of scale. Buyers should negotiate MOQs to secure favorable pricing.

  • Specifications and Customization: Customizing smartphones with specific features or branding can lead to higher costs. Buyers should evaluate whether the added specifications justify the price increase.

  • Materials and Quality Certifications: The choice of materials affects both the quality and cost. Additionally, certifications (such as ISO or CE) may add to costs but can enhance marketability.

  • Supplier Factors: Supplier reputation, reliability, and financial stability can influence pricing. It’s beneficial to assess potential suppliers based on their track record.

  • Incoterms: The terms of shipping and delivery can significantly impact pricing. Buyers should understand Incoterms to clarify responsibilities and costs associated with shipping.

Essential Technical Properties and Trade Terminology for smartphone manufacturer

What Are the Key Technical Properties for Smartphone Manufacturing?

In the highly competitive smartphone market, understanding essential technical properties is crucial for international B2B buyers. Here are some critical specifications to consider when evaluating smartphone manufacturers:

1. Material Grade

The choice of materials significantly impacts the durability and performance of smartphones. Common materials include aluminum for frames, glass for screens, and various polymers for internal components. Higher material grades can enhance device strength and aesthetics, which are vital for customer satisfaction and brand reputation. Buyers should inquire about material certifications to ensure compliance with international standards.

2. Tolerance Levels

Tolerance refers to the permissible limit of variation in a manufactured component’s dimensions. In smartphone manufacturing, maintaining tight tolerances ensures that parts fit together perfectly, which is essential for device performance and longevity. Loose tolerances can lead to issues such as component misalignment, affecting functionality. Buyers should specify acceptable tolerance levels in their contracts to avoid quality discrepancies.

3. Battery Capacity and Technology

Battery specifications, including capacity (measured in milliampere-hours, or mAh) and technology (such as lithium-ion or lithium-polymer), are critical for ensuring long-lasting performance. A higher capacity usually translates to longer usage times between charges, which is a significant selling point. Buyers must assess battery performance metrics to align with market demands for longevity and quick charging capabilities.

4. Display Specifications

Display quality can make or break a smartphone’s user experience. Key specifications include resolution (e.g., Full HD, 4K), screen size, and technology (such as AMOLED or LCD). Buyers should prioritize displays that offer vibrant colors, high contrast, and energy efficiency. Understanding these specifications helps in choosing devices that appeal to target markets, particularly in regions where visual content consumption is high.

5. Processor Performance

The processor is the heart of a smartphone, influencing its speed and efficiency. Key metrics include the number of cores, clock speed (measured in GHz), and architecture (e.g., ARM vs. x86). A powerful processor ensures smooth multitasking and better overall performance. B2B buyers should assess processor capabilities to meet the demands of modern applications and consumer expectations.

What Are Common Trade Terms in Smartphone Manufacturing?

Navigating the smartphone manufacturing landscape requires familiarity with specific industry jargon. Here are some common trade terms that B2B buyers should know:

1. OEM (Original Equipment Manufacturer)

An OEM is a company that produces components or products that are sold under another company’s brand. In smartphone manufacturing, this often refers to companies that manufacture devices for well-known brands. Understanding OEM relationships can help buyers identify quality and reliability in their sourcing decisions.

2. MOQ (Minimum Order Quantity)

MOQ refers to the smallest quantity of a product that a supplier is willing to sell. This term is vital for B2B buyers to understand, as it can affect inventory management and cash flow. Negotiating MOQs can lead to better pricing and reduced risk for smaller businesses looking to enter the smartphone market.

3. RFQ (Request for Quotation)

An RFQ is a document sent to suppliers requesting a quote for specific products or services. This term is essential for buyers looking to source components or devices, as it helps in obtaining competitive pricing and terms. A well-structured RFQ can significantly streamline the procurement process.

4. Incoterms (International Commercial Terms)

Incoterms are standardized terms that define the responsibilities of buyers and sellers in international trade. They clarify who is responsible for shipping, insurance, and tariffs. Understanding Incoterms is crucial for B2B buyers, especially when importing smartphones or components from different countries, to avoid unexpected costs.

5. Lead Time

Lead time is the duration from the initiation of an order to its delivery. In smartphone manufacturing, this can vary significantly based on production schedules and supply chain dynamics. Buyers should factor in lead times when planning inventory and product launches to meet market demands effectively.

Frequently Asked Questions (FAQs) for B2B Buyers of smartphone manufacturer

  1. How do I choose the right smartphone manufacturer for my business needs?
    Selecting the right smartphone manufacturer involves assessing several factors: product quality, manufacturing capacity, customization options, and after-sales support. Start by researching potential manufacturers’ reputations and customer reviews. Request samples to evaluate build quality and performance. Additionally, consider the manufacturer’s ability to meet your specific requirements, such as branding and software customization. Establish clear communication to ensure they understand your needs, and assess their capacity to scale production based on your anticipated demand.

  2. What are the minimum order quantities (MOQ) for smartphone manufacturers?
    Minimum order quantities (MOQ) can vary significantly among smartphone manufacturers, often ranging from 100 to several thousand units. When negotiating, inquire about MOQs that align with your budget and market strategy. Some manufacturers may offer flexible MOQs for new partnerships or smaller businesses. It’s essential to factor in your sales projections and inventory management when determining the most viable MOQ for your operations.

  3. What customization options do smartphone manufacturers offer?
    Smartphone manufacturers typically provide a range of customization options, including hardware specifications, software interfaces, and branding elements. Common customizations include modified camera systems, battery capacity, and pre-installed applications. Ensure to discuss your specific requirements during the negotiation phase. It’s also crucial to understand the implications of customizations on production timelines and costs, as more extensive modifications may lead to longer lead times and higher prices.

  4. How can I vet a smartphone manufacturer before placing an order?
    Vetting a smartphone manufacturer is essential to mitigate risks in international trade. Start by verifying their business credentials, such as certifications and industry affiliations. Request references from previous clients and review case studies of similar projects. Conduct factory visits or virtual tours to assess production capabilities and quality control processes. Additionally, consider using third-party inspection services to evaluate product quality before shipment, ensuring that they meet your specifications.

  5. What payment terms are commonly used in B2B transactions with smartphone manufacturers?
    Payment terms can vary, but common arrangements include a deposit upfront (typically 30-50%) with the remaining balance due upon shipment or delivery. Some manufacturers may offer credit terms for established relationships. Always clarify payment methods accepted, such as wire transfers or letters of credit, and ensure you have a clear agreement in writing. Be cautious of manufacturers demanding full payment before production, as this may indicate a higher risk of fraud.

  6. What are the logistics considerations when importing smartphones?
    Importing smartphones involves several logistics considerations, including shipping methods, customs regulations, and delivery timelines. Choose a reliable freight forwarder familiar with electronics to navigate the complexities of international shipping. Be aware of import duties, taxes, and compliance with local regulations in your country. It’s advisable to establish clear communication with your supplier regarding shipping schedules and to track shipments to anticipate any potential delays.

  7. How do I ensure quality assurance when sourcing smartphones?
    Quality assurance is critical when sourcing smartphones to ensure product reliability. Implement a robust QA process that includes setting clear quality standards, conducting pre-shipment inspections, and requiring manufacturers to provide quality certificates. Establish regular communication to monitor production progress and address any issues promptly. Consider including warranty clauses in your contracts to protect your business against defective products.

  8. What are the common challenges faced when sourcing smartphones internationally?
    Sourcing smartphones internationally can present challenges such as cultural differences, language barriers, and varying regulatory standards. Be prepared for potential delays in production and shipping due to unforeseen circumstances like political instability or natural disasters. It’s important to have a contingency plan, including alternative suppliers or logistics options. Building strong relationships with manufacturers can help mitigate these challenges and ensure smoother transactions.
